Location
Located just a few steps from the historical Porta Pia, one of the last most important Michelangelo's works of art, the Galeno Hotel Rome is placed just a 5-minute walk from the main Roman Universities, La Sapienza and the Luiss University. In the proximity of the hotel are some of the most important foreign embassies in Italy and the area is also the headquarters of some important Italian Ministries such as the Ministry of Public Works and Transports.

Galeno Hotel Rome Guest Reviews
Bad hotel. Pictures are better that the hotel itself. Very noisy, very!!!! Rooms are tiny. We asked for privat room for 2. Instead of one bed, we had 2 small beds, that were united. I would not recommend to stay in this hotel.
Anonymous wrote on August 8, 2010
Hotel location was okay, 10 minute walk to Termini or 5 minute walk to metro station. Service was bad. Hotel has no laundry, they don't know where a laundry is and didn't want to find out for us (laundries are near termini). No aircon, had to ask for a fan. Hallways are cluttered up with old furniture. Room was tiny and bathroom was the smallest bathroom I have ever had. You have to leave your key with reception every time you go out which i didn't like. Breakfast was good.
